One thing to remember about the 400 is that it is a Suzuki, no matter what color the plastic. It will not have the same engine mounts as a 250F or 450F, so you will have to modify the engine cradle again if you switch it later. Truth be told, the 250F is also a Suzuki, considering they designed it when they were working with Kawasaki. Be patient, you'll find a 450F. Like 3Razors suggested, the KLX450F is a five speed, has lights, and could easily be retrofitted with a kick starter using factory parts. Kawasaki might even have a kit for it. Once again, be patient. The 450F just came out recently, so there aren't as many of them around just yet. Please don't put a Suzuki engine in it. Keep it all Kawasaki.
